    Registered nurses (RNs), regardless of specialty or work setting, treat patients, educate patients and the public about various medical conditions, and provide advice and emotional support to patients' family members. RNs record patients' medical histories and symptoms, help perform diagnostic tests and analyze results, operate medical machinery, administer treatment and medications, and help with patient follow-up and rehabilitation.

    •Registered nurses constitute the largest healthcare occupation, with 2.6 million jobs.
    •The three typical educational paths to registered nursing are a bachelor's degree, an associate degree, and a diploma from an approved nursing program; advanced practice nurses — clinical nurse specialists, nurse anesthetists, nurse-midwives, and nurse practitioners — need a master’s degree.
    •Job opportunities are expected to be excellent, but may vary by employment and geographic setting; some employers report difficulty in attracting and retaining an adequate number of RNs.

  15. hi, i have seen this topic come up from time to time for career, and I think it is because there are plenty of people who are just as frugal as me. Have done much searching online for free courses that for free , while they may not offer credit, do offer an opportunity to learn something new. You can then take that knowledge and try to get credit for it through CLEP/Dantes or Prior Learning Assessment.

    This is what EVERYONE should keep in mind when pursuing free courses. They are for your own benefit - but, could help you gain credit through testing. The certificates you get from some free online classes won't get you very far unless you are planning on testing out of classes that will count towards your degree.
